For catalytic capital, Aqua for All looks for fund managers with an impact

Impact-driven fund managers with private debt, private equity, natural capital, infrastructure, or other real-asset strategies are encouraged to apply for catalytic funding from Aqua for All in order to expand their influence in emerging markets across water, sanitation, and closely related nexus sectors like energy and climate.
In order to help de-risk investments and mobilize private sector finance while producing quantifiable environmental and social effects, Aqua for All will offer equity or first-loss equity together with technical assistance.
“We seek to partner with fund managers who have a strong track record of deploying capital effectively in emerging markets to advance SDG 6,” said Aqua for All.
Building on the initial call for fund manager applications that was issued a year ago in collaboration with the Swiss Agency for Development and Cooperation (SDC) under the Catalyzing Impact with Innovative Financing program, this is the organization’s second call.
To encourage private capital engagement, the initiative gives up to EUR150,000 (US$170,000) in technical assistance in addition to investments ranging from EUR1 million (US$1.15 million) to EUR5 million (US$5.7 million) in private funds.
